We didn’t go for staying power, and here it is two hours later:
Pencils’ trial tip: Ask your stylists to do your hair exactly as they would the day of, if they have time. We didn’t spend extensive time on getting curls that stay, or braiding straight, and the hair fell flat pretty quickly.
